Working on some 168 ABLR seating depth tests.
The first batch I just slammed in at 2.80 book length, but they weren't happy and grouped about 1.3
So I'm trying 2.82, 2.83, and 2.85 lengths next.
So the jump lengths will be
.067 (no go)
.047
.037
.017
I've heard a few comments that 0.05 worked, and 0.02 worked. But these have a reputation of being a little picky even in a match grade barrel.

I can stack most any 165/168 bullet on 44 to 45 grains of Varget and get a cloverleaf, but these are going to make me work for it. Hopefully one or two of the groups will tighten up and then I can do a little fine tweak.

In my experience, start real close, like almost jammed and work back in .010 increments. In my chambers which are not SAAMI, they don’t like to be much more than about .030 off.
 
What setup are you using?

Pretty basic stuff, RCBS RC-II press, RCBS auto prime, Lyman case prep station, hornady auto powder thrower. I try to size a ton of brass, clean off lube, and prep cases a few nights a week, then nights like last night I prime cases and drop powder. I’ve wanted to update my press but I’ve had such good results with all my cartridges this has been fine for me. I just plan ahead for matches and load accordingly so I don’t get behind.
